Job overview

Monkton Combe School is an independent boarding and day school for pupils aged 2 to 18, with 700 pupils, situated just outside of Bath,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, in an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. Following the recent announcement of Chris Wheeler’s appointment as Head of Canford School, the Board of Governors is seeking to appoint a new Principal of the Monkton Family of Schools.


Monkton is distinguished by its living Christian ethos, which is about faith rather than religion. The Christian life of the School is as rich and diverse as the School itself and pupils are encouraged to explore faith. 


Monkton is a place with a strong sense of community where there is an openness to innovation and development, within a culture of mutual respect. Placing a high premium on excellent pastoral care and personal development, Monkton holds true to the belief that being known, being inspired and being ambitious is the key to fulfilment. Our ethos is built upon the belief that happy children learn in a safe environment that allows them to explore their strengths and weaknesses, develop resilience and face challenges with courage. We believe in the power of stretching and challenging our pupils across the breadth of school life, in the knowledge that learning will take place through the process, whatever the outcome. This is all enhanced through our boarding ethos which plays a crucial role in building character, fostering independence, resilience, a strong sense of responsibility and lifelong friendships. Monkton's supportive boarding environment ensures that all pupils, whether boarders or day, benefit from and enjoy the best of boarding life.


In 2022, Monkton Combe School merged with All Hallows Prep School near Frome to form the Monkton Family of Schools. The Principal manages the School on an integrated basis across all its constituent parts, providing unified and consistent leadership and direction while also acting as Head of the Senior School.


The role of Principal demands an active Christian faith and an ability to articulate authentically this faith with confidence and relevance. The Board is seeking someone with a vision for Monkton, in terms of defining, delivering and promoting the 'Monkton Experience’.

About Monkton Combe School

Monkton Combe School is an independent, co-educational, mainstream, all-through school, catering for children aged 2-18. Situated just a mile from Bath, in Somerset, the school takes boarders and day pupils. It maintains a strong Christian ethos and is proud of its exam results and reputation for good pastoral care.   

Monkton Combe School was founded as a senior school in 1868 by Reverend Francis Pocock, who had previously been shipwrecked on his return from West Africa. Just six boys joined his class in the Lent term, but the school expanded over the course of 20 years and in 1888 the junior school opened. Now 400 boys and girls attend Monkton Senior.   

Monkton pre-prep was founded in 1937 and caters for 120 boys and girls aged 2-7. In September 2016 it moved from Combe Down to a new building on the prep school site.     

Girls joined the school in 1992 when Clarendon School merged with Monkton Combe. Clarendon continues to flourish as a girls’ boarding house at the school.

Values and vision 

Monkton Combe School’s values are summarised by "confidence, integrity, humility and service". Its vision is to inspire young people to become confident, kind and ambitious adults who live fulfilling lives. Monkton Combe School’s mission is to create a foundation based on a proactive pastoral environment to develop academically strong and enthusiastic learners within a strong Christian ethos.
